Abilities Arts Festival - A Celebration of Disability Arts and Culture

Abilities Arts Festival - A Celebration of Disability Arts and Culture: "Abilities Arts Festival is a disability arts organization that promotes diversity, inclusiveness and the power of art as a means of enriching the cultural fabric of our communities. Through multidisciplinary, visual, film and performing arts festivals, workshops and special events, Abilities Arts Festival showcases artistic excellence by artists with disabilities. The festival uses dynamic and powerful artistic presentations by artists with disabilities to positively impact attitudes and to help ensure an arts and culture sector that is both inclusive of people with disabilities and one that is enhanced through their participation."

CAVE - Communities Advancing Valued Enviroments - Transforming communities

CAVE - Communities Advancing Valued Enviroments - Transforming communities: "CAVE is an acronym for Communities Advancing Valued Environments. CAVE was formed in 2004 after recognizing the need for community building in the Greater Toronto Area. CAVE has established itself in the GTA as an organization that strives to transform communities through various initiatives, primarily Graffiti Transformation Projects. "

AdiZeharia.com

AdiZeharia.com

These paintings, normally acrylic and oil on masonite, explore both the dignities, and the failures of man-made and natural structures, and draw whimsical parallels between what is sometimes thought to be two separate and colliding worlds. The style I have employed, of breaking up forms into shapes, is both of aesthetic interest to me to create a playful atmosphere, and an indication of the tendency of natural and technological structures to break apart and reformulate

Arts Etobicoke, a community art gallery is hosting an exhibit of Laser Eagles Artists work. Laser Eagles Art Guild is a program that provides opportunity for people with limited or no speech and with restricted use of their limbs to partner with others in their community in the creation of art.
As the master tracker of Laser Eagles I am particularly pleased to tell you about the inspiring pieces of art created by the group.
